Driving School Policies


Cancellation & No Show Policy and Fees


Just like all other driving schools, Homeland Driving School and its other affiliate schools have a strict cancellation and no show policy.  To Cancel a lesson, you must call our office at least 24 hours prior to your scheduled appointment time to give us notice or you will be charged a $75 cancellation fee. Unfortunately, no matter what the reason is for cancelling we must charge the $75 fee so please make sure if you are feeling sick that you call us before the 24 hours to reschedule the lesson. If you are calling during non-business hours to cancel a lesson, please leave the students name, appointment date, time and instructors name if known.


On rare occasions Homeland Driving School may have to cancel a lesson on short notice due to an instructor illness or some other unforeseen circumstance. Homeland Driving School will not be liable for any Cancellation fee paid to the Student for us cancelling and rescheduling a lesson.


We confirm appointments by email not phone. Sometimes our emails go to spam so please check all your email boxes and make sure to write your appointment date and time down.  You are welcome to call our offices to confirm your appointment or to ask when your appointment is scheduled. 


If we show up to the lesson and the student is not there, our instructor will wait 15 minutes then they will leave and student will be charged $75 for a no show fee. If you running late, please call the office at 951-923-3336 to let us know the status of your arrival so that we can let the instructor know to wait for you. If you do not show up for any reason and we have to cancel the lesson, you will be charged $75.


You must have your permit with you for each lesson (copy is acceptable.)  If we show up and you do not have your permit we cannot legally take you on the lesson and you will be charged $75 for not having your permit.  Please make a few copies of your permit once the instructor has signed it.

Time Period to Complete Course


Online and In-Class Drivers Education Courses must be completed within 6 months of registration unless otherwise agreed to in writing by Driving School. Behind the Wheel lessons must be completed within 1 year of registration or there may be a $60 per lesson fee charged for any lessons still remaining unless otherwise agreed upon in writing by Driving School. We asked that if you are having trouble completing your course (Drivers Ed or Behind the Wheel) that you contact our offices to make arrangements for additional time. Online Completion Certificates / Replacement Certificate Fees


The DMV Requires an original certificate of completion for both Driver's Education Online and 6 Hours of BTW Completion. Once we get notified of you completing our online course we will mail you the original certificate usually within 1 - 2 business days. You may also come by our office and pick up an original copy. If you choose to do this option, please email us or call our office to let us know that you would like to pick it up and we will be happy to have it ready for you.

If you lose your original certificate of completion and require a replacement Driver's Education (Online or Classroom) or Behind the Wheel Completion Certificate there will be a replacement fee of $10 for us to issue a new one.
